> Well, I am glad you have found something unreasaonable about 'stop'.
> Let us see API 'rte_eth_dev_stop'
> 
> rte_eth_dev_stop(dev)
> {
>      ....
>      dev->data->dev_started = 0;
>      ret = (*dev->dev_ops->dev_stop)(dev)
>      retur ret;
> }
> This is unreasaonable. No matter 'dev_ops->dev_stop' succeed or fail,
> the state 'dev_started ' will always set to be '0'.
> 
> But this does not only influence bonding device but other devices like
> eth dev or vdev.
> This is the bug in rte ethdev level. I will send another patch to fix
> it.
> 

Hi Connor,

I agree this is an issue in the API, cc'ed Andrew and Thomas.

I vaguely remember that "dev_started = 0" was required for some dev_ops, 
but not quite sure, let me check this.
At worst we can do as following to be sure:

   dev->data->dev_started = 0;
   ret = (*dev->dev_ops->dev_stop)(dev)
   if (ret)
     dev->data->dev_started = 1;

Also we need to clarify in the API documentation (.h file), what is the 
status of the device if 'rte_eth_dev_stop()' returned error.


Btw, would you be OK to separate this ethdev patch from your bonding 
patch, to not stuck your series because of ethdev one.
